When Apple announced generative AI features for Siri at WWDC 2024, the club erupted. “It felt like validation,” Chen says. “For years, people said Siri was dead. Now, she’s getting a brain upgrade, and we were here first.” The Siri Fan Club has evolved into a support network

But not everyone is thrilled. Some purists worry that a smarter, more proactive Siri might lose her deadpan charm. “I don’t want her to be ChatGPT,” argues Park. “I want her to be Siri — weird, private, and occasionally wrong in delightful ways.” If you’re intrigued, the Siri Fan Club welcomes new members with one simple rule: Don’t get angry when she misunderstands you. Laugh instead.
